That this House regrets that the present Government will suffer the fate of all other recent governments by ending their term of office with illegal drug use at a higher level than when they were elected; urges front bench spokespeople of all parties to stop misrepresenting drug reforms in the Netherlands; and notes that 30 years of harsh drug penalties in the UK have increase drug use and deaths while 25 years of regulated decriminalisation in the Netherlands has reduced all drug use and deaths.
